Claire R Mcisaac 1906 - 1996

Claire R Mcisaac was born on February 21, 1906, and died at age 90 years old on June 29, 1996. Family, friend, or fan, this family history biography is for you to remember Claire R Mcisaac.

In 1936, she was 30 years old when on November 3rd, President Franklin Delano Roosevelt was reelected to a second term. He ran against Republican Governor Alf Landon (Kansas), defeating Landon in the popular vote by 60.8% to 36.5%. Vermont and Maine were the only two states in which Landon won. John Nance Garner IV became the Vice-President in this election.
